Exemplo n.º 1
0
    private void cargarCiudad()
    {
        string provincias = ddlprovincia.SelectedValue;

        if (provincias != "Sin Provincias")
        {
            ServicioCom21.ServicioCom21 _consulta = new ServicioCom21.ServicioCom21();
            DataSet _provincias = _consulta.Com21_consulta_ciudad_idprovincia(int.Parse(provincias));
            if (_provincias.Tables[0].Rows.Count > 0)
            {
                ddlciudad.Items.Clear();
                ddlciudad.DataSource     = _provincias.Tables[0];
                ddlciudad.DataTextField  = "Ciudad";
                ddlciudad.DataValueField = "Id_Ciudad";
                ddlciudad.DataBind();
            }
            else
            {
                ddlciudad.Items.Clear();
                ddlciudad.Items.Insert(0, "Sin Ciudades");
            }
        }
        else
        {
            ddlciudad.Items.Clear();
            ddlciudad.Items.Insert(0, "Sin Ciudades");
        }
    }
Exemplo n.º 2
0
 protected void GvPais_RowDeleting(object sender, GridViewDeleteEventArgs e)
 {
     try
     {
         String IdPais = GvPais.DataKeys[e.RowIndex].Value.ToString();
         ServicioCom21.ServicioCom21 _usuario = new ServicioCom21.ServicioCom21();
         if (_usuario.Com21_elimina_pais(int.Parse(IdPais)))
         {
             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Error no se pudo Eliminar');", true);
         }
         else
         {
             //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Registro Eliminado');", true);
             DataSet _provincias = _usuario.Com21_consulta_provincias_idpais(int.Parse(IdPais));
             if (_usuario.Com21_elimina_provincia_pais(int.Parse(IdPais)))
             {
             }
             else
             {
                 if (_provincias.Tables[0].Rows.Count > 0)
                 {
                     foreach (DataRow r in _provincias.Tables[0].Rows)
                     {
                         DataSet _ciudad = _usuario.Com21_consulta_ciudad_idprovincia(int.Parse(r["Id_Provincia"].ToString()));
                         if (_usuario.Com21_elimina_provincias_Ciudades(int.Parse(r["Id_Provincia"].ToString())))
                         {
                             //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Error no se pudo Eliminar');", true);
                         }
                         else
                         {
                             if (_ciudad.Tables[0].Rows.Count > 0)
                             {
                                 foreach (DataRow rci in _ciudad.Tables[0].Rows)
                                 {
                                     if (_usuario.Com21_elimina_ciudad_costo(int.Parse(rci["Id_Ciudad"].ToString())))
                                     {
                                         //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Error no se pudo Eliminar');", true);
                                     }
                                     else
                                     {
                                     }
                                 }
                             }
                         }
                     }
                 }
             }
             Consulta_Paises();
         }
     }
     catch (Exception Ex)
     {
         Console.WriteLine(Ex.Message);
         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Problemas Tecnicos Por favor Comunicarse con el Administrador del Sitio');", true);
     }
 }
Exemplo n.º 3
0
    private void cargarciudadDatos()
    {
        try
        {
            string id = ddlprovinciadatos.SelectedValue.ToString();
            if (id != "0")
            {
                ServicioCom21.ServicioCom21 _consulta = new ServicioCom21.ServicioCom21();
                DataSet _provincias = _consulta.Com21_consulta_ciudad_idprovincia(int.Parse(id));
                if (_provincias.Tables[0].Rows.Count > 0)
                {
                    ddlciudaddatos.DataSource     = _provincias.Tables[0];
                    ddlciudaddatos.DataTextField  = "Ciudad";
                    ddlciudaddatos.DataValueField = "Id_Ciudad";
                    ddlciudaddatos.DataBind();
                }
                else
                {
                    ListItem _ddl = new ListItem();
                    _ddl.Text  = "No existen ciudades";
                    _ddl.Value = "0";
                    ddlciudaddatos.Items.Clear();

                    ddlciudaddatos.Items.Add(_ddl);
                    ddlciudaddatos.DataBind();
                }
            }
            else
            {
                ListItem _ddl = new ListItem();
                _ddl.Text  = "No existen ciudades";
                _ddl.Value = "0";
                ddlciudad.Items.Clear();

                ddlciudad.Items.Add(_ddl);
                ddlciudad.DataBind();
            }
        }
        catch (Exception ex)
        {
        }
    }
Exemplo n.º 4
0
    protected void ddlprovincia_SelectedIndexChanged(object sender, EventArgs e)
    {
        string id = ddlprovincia.SelectedValue.ToString();

        if (int.Parse(id) != 0)
        {
            Consulta_Empresa();
            ServicioCom21.ServicioCom21 _consulta = new ServicioCom21.ServicioCom21();
            DataSet _provincias = _consulta.Com21_consulta_ciudad_idprovincia(int.Parse(id));
            if (_provincias.Tables[0].Rows.Count > 0)
            {
                ddlciudad.DataSource     = _provincias.Tables[0];
                ddlciudad.DataTextField  = "Ciudad";
                ddlciudad.DataValueField = "Id_Ciudad";
                ddlciudad.DataBind();
            }
            else
            {
                ListItem _ddl = new ListItem();
                _ddl.Text  = "No existen ciudades";
                _ddl.Value = "0";
                ddlciudad.Items.Clear();

                ddlciudad.Items.Add(_ddl);
                ddlciudad.DataBind();
            }
        }
        else
        {
            ListItem _ddl = new ListItem();
            _ddl.Text  = "No existen ciudades";
            _ddl.Value = "0";
            ddlciudad.Items.Clear();

            ddlciudad.Items.Add(_ddl);
            ddlciudad.DataBind();
        }
    }
Exemplo n.º 5
0
    private void elimina_Ciudades_Costos(String IdProvincias)
    {
        ServicioCom21.ServicioCom21 _consulta = new ServicioCom21.ServicioCom21();
        DataSet _provincias = _consulta.Com21_consulta_ciudad_idprovincia(int.Parse(IdProvincias));

        if (_consulta.Com21_elimina_provincias_Ciudades(int.Parse(IdProvincias)))
        {
        }
        else
        {
            foreach (DataRow r in _provincias.Tables[0].Rows)
            {
                if (_consulta.Com21_elimina_ciudad_costo(int.Parse(r["Id_Ciudad"].ToString())))
                {
                    //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Error no se pudo Eliminar');", true);
                }
                else
                {
                    //ScriptManager.RegisterStartupScript(upMantenimiento, upMantenimiento.GetType(), "click", "alert('Ciudad y Costo Eliminados');", true);
                }
            }
        }
    }